My Buying Guides on Tri Fold Couch Bed
What I Look For First
When I shop for a tri fold couch bed, I start with comfort and size. I want it to work both as a couch and as a bed without feeling too stiff or too thin. I also check whether it fits my room, because some models look compact in pictures but take up more space when fully opened.
My Priority: Comfort and Support
For me, the biggest factor is how it feels to sit and sleep on. I look for enough cushioning so my back does not hurt after a long evening or a night’s sleep. I also pay attention to support, especially if I plan to use it often. A good tri fold couch bed should not sink too much or feel uneven.
Material and Build Quality I Trust
I always check the outer fabric and the foam inside. A durable cover matters because it should handle daily use, spills, and regular folding. I prefer materials that feel soft but still hold up well over time. The stitching and seams matter too, since weak construction can wear out quickly.
Size and Portability That Fit My Space
I measure my room before buying. I want to know how much floor space it needs when folded and unfolded. If I plan to move it around often, I look for a lightweight option with handles or an easy-to-carry design. Portability is important to me, especially for small apartments, guest rooms, or dorms.
Ease of Folding and Storage
I like a tri fold couch bed that is simple to convert. If it takes too much effort, I know I will use it less often. I also look for a design that folds neatly and stores easily in a closet or corner. The smoother the folding process, the more practical it feels in everyday life.
My Check on Versatility
I prefer a couch bed that can do more than one job. Some models can be used for lounging, reading, gaming, or sleeping. I find that versatility makes the purchase more worthwhile. If it works well in different settings, I feel better about spending the money.
Cleaning and Maintenance I Consider
I always think about upkeep before buying. A removable or easy-to-clean cover is a big plus for me. If the fabric resists stains or wipes clean easily, I know it will stay looking better for longer. Low-maintenance options save me time and stress.
My Budget and Value Choice
I compare price with quality rather than choosing the cheapest option. A lower price is not always a better deal if the couch bed wears out quickly. I look for something that gives me good comfort, strong construction, and useful features for the amount I spend. For me, value matters more than price alone.
